Hi

Despite checking Windows 10 firewall allows private access to Sonos controller and Sonos library, I am still geting "Unable to play 'xyz.mp3' - unable to conect to //room/user

Sometimes it works, sometimes doesn't. 

Has anybody had this?

I recommend you get in touch with our technical support team, who have tools at their disposal that will allow them to give you advice specific to your Sonos system and what it reports, but before you do so, please make sure your Windows 10 PC knows that it is on a Private network, or it will ignore all local requests for communication from other devices, like your Sonos speakers. This is the most common cause for such connection problems.
